As far as I know, if you turn your city into a Stronghold:

- Your Militia members get a +50 bonus to all defensive rolls when inside the city.
- If any of the citizens (overt) is being attacked, then you (covert) can "help" him (attack the one attacking him). This technique is the common way used to protect Novice Jedi.

But the thing is that I have never done it before (these are just my thoughts from things I've seen and heard). So, if I turn the city into a Stronghold:

1. Will the above two points be true?

2. Do I still have to add the members into the City Militia, or they will be able to behave like above just because of the fact of being a Stronghold? (adding citizens to Militia can be risky some times because you really have to trust who you add, as they are kind of powerful then).

3. Any extra information I should be aware of?

yes they get a +50 bonus, and yes the must be on militia to recieve the bonus. and do be careful who you put on militia, they can grant zoning rights to anyone.

TsothaLanti wrote:

- If any of the citizens (overt) is being attacked, then you (covert) can "help" him (attack the one attacking him). This technique is the common way used to protect Novice Jedi.




I don't think this is true... Any special abilities for Militia members to attack other player outside the normal rules of PVP were removed when they took out the citywarn command.


And I've yet to see anybody come in here with any kind of confidence and say the defensive bonus is working.


Basically, militia members are useful for giving people zoning rights and that's about it. The Stronghold specialization probably isn't worth the money it costs.
